    Key Elements of Bali Villa Interior Design

    When we talk about Bali villa interior design, several key elements come to the forefront. These elements combine to create spaces that are not only visually stunning but also deeply connected to the island's culture and natural beauty. One of the most important elements is the use of natural materials. Teak wood, bamboo, stone, and rattan are commonly used in furniture, flooring, and decorative elements. These materials not only add to the aesthetic appeal but also create a sense of warmth and authenticity. Another key element is the incorporation of traditional Balinese motifs. Intricate carvings, colorful textiles, and religious symbols are often used to add a touch of local flavor to the interiors. These details serve as a reminder of the island's rich cultural heritage. Open floor plans are also a hallmark of Bali villa design. These layouts allow for a seamless flow between indoor and outdoor spaces, maximizing the connection to the surrounding environment. Large windows, sliding glass doors, and expansive terraces are used to bring the outdoors in. The use of water features is another common element. Infinity pools, fountains, and ponds are often incorporated into the design to create a sense of tranquility and relaxation. The sound of running water can be incredibly soothing, and the visual appeal of these features adds to the overall ambiance of the villa. Finally, lighting plays a crucial role in Bali villa interior design. Soft, ambient lighting is used to create a warm and inviting atmosphere. Natural light is maximized during the day, while strategically placed lamps and sconces provide illumination at night. The goal is to create a space that's both functional and aesthetically pleasing.
